Did you know your employer also pays tax on your salary? It costs the employer 15 553 kr to pay you 49 501 kr. In other words, every time you spend 10 kr of your hard-earned money, 6.85 kr goes to the government.
Real tax rate
52.1%
So, with you and the employer both paying tax, what used to be a 37.1% tax rate now rises to 52.1%, meaning your real tax rate is actually 15% higher than what it seemed at first.
Summary
If you make 594 012 kr a year living in the region of Blekinge, Sweden, you will be taxed 220 115 kr. That means that your net pay will be 373 897 kr per year, or 31 158 kr per month. Your average tax rate is 37.1% and your marginal tax rate is 54.6%. This marginal tax rate means that your immediate additional income will be taxed at this rate. For instance, an increase of 100 kr in your salary will be taxed 54.62 kr, hence, your net pay will only increase by 45.38 kr.
